Newly surfaced colorized images from the 1960s offer a glimpse into Goldie Hawn's life before fame, revealing the actress as a pixie-cut high school student active in theater and drama. Hawn's journey from Montgomery Blair High School to Oscar glory and decades-long partnership with Kurt Russell highlights her willingness to take risks, follow her passions, and prioritize personal freedom in both her career and relationships.

The details

After leaving high school in 1964, Hawn initially enrolled at American University to study drama but soon dropped out to pursue a career as a professional ballet teacher. This risk-taking spirit would later influence her big break in Hollywood, with her Oscar-winning performance in 'Cactus Flower' in 1968 launching her to stardom. Over the decades, Hawn has maintained her relevance and popularity, in part due to her unique approach to relationships exemplified by her 43-year partnership with Kurt Russell.

  • Goldie Hawn graduated from Montgomery Blair High School in Silver Spring, Maryland in 1964.
  • Hawn enrolled at American University in 1964 but soon dropped out to teach ballet.
  • Hawn landed her first major acting role in 1968, starring in the film 'Cactus Flower'.
  • Hawn and Kurt Russell have been in a long-term unmarried partnership since the early 1980s.
